We are seeking a reliable, dedicated, experienced Clinical Research Billing Associate to join our growing team.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S & Q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Billing and collection for clinical research patient’s standard of care services.
  • Works closely with insurances to achieve timely billing and collection.
  • Ensures billing compliance by determining how clinical research protocol items and services are billed per federal agency guidelines through the conduct of Medicare Coverage Analysis.
  • Performing quality control and quality assurance measures over clinical research billing (trial opening to close-out).
  • Posting of Research payments and breakdowns in the EMR
  • Conduct financial reconciliation for all services provided to research patients (reviewing and comparing services captured in CTMS and EMR) to achieve billing compliance.
  • Provide financial counseling for research patients upon consenting and during study participation on trial coverage and patient responsibility.
  • Ability to bill out Standard of Care (SOC) services, coding certification preferred.
  • Experience with the use of Clinical Trials Management System (CTMS), preferably RealTime CTMS.
  • Clinical Trial Billing Certified required
  • Obtain authorization for oncology treatments given within clinical trials as standard of care and handles denials.
  • Experience with sponsored oncology clinical research trials
  • Reports to Director of Clinical Research Operations and will work closely with the billing team, finance team, authorization and the clinical research team.
